Oxindole (2) is a potent and selective PDE2 inhibitor with a favorable ADME, physiochemical and pharmacokinetic profile to allow for use as a chemical tool in elucidating the physiological role of PDE2.

Tricyclic oxindole carboxamides, prepared by (a) reaction of an isocyanate with the basic ring system or (b) ammonolysis of a corresponding alkyl ester, are non-steroidal antiinflammatory agents useful in the treatment of rheumatoid arthritis.
